Advantages of Investment Casting?

Sector Advantages Driving Adoption: The Go-To Solution for Precision Metal Parts

_

Precision and Accuracy
Produces parts with tight dimensional tolerances (CT6–CT8) and excellent surface finishes (Ra 6.4–12.5 µm). Ideal for complex geometries and thin-walled components.
Superior Surface Quality
Delivers smooth as-cast surfaces, reducing or eliminating the need for post-processing such as grinding or polishing.
Design Freedom
Enables intricate designs, sharp edges, 90° angles, and complex internal features without the limitations of draft angles.
Material Versatility
Compatible with a wide range of metals, including carbon steel, alloy steel, stainless steel, and non-ferrous alloys — offering excellent flexibility for engineering applications.
Complex Part Integration
Allows casting of multi-functional components with integrated features, reducing the need for assembly and improving structural integrity.
Cost Efficiency
Minimises waste through near-net-shape production. Reduces machining, assembly, and material costs — particularly effective for small to medium batch sizes.
Flexible Production
Suited to low to medium volume production runs (from 100 units), with relatively low tooling investment compared to other precision casting methods.

Processing of Lost Wax Casting?

Provides hot chamber die casing for industries

_

Creating a precise wax pattern and coating it with ceramic to form a mould is the process of lost wax casting, also known as investment casting. The wax is subsequently melted away, leaving a hollow shell into which molten metal is poured. After cooling, the ceramic mould is broken to reveal a detailed metal casting, which is then cleaned and finished. This process is ideal for producing complex, high-precision metal parts with excellent surface quality.

Types of Investment Casting

Traditional Lost Wax Casting
The classic process in which wax patterns are made, coated with ceramic, and subsequently melted out to create a mould for metal pouring.

Lost Foam Casting
Utilises a foam pattern instead of wax, which evaporates during the metal pouring, making it suitable for complex shapes.

Shell Moulding
Involves the creation of a thin ceramic shell around the pattern, ideal for small, detailed components.

Diverse applications

Investment casting, or lost wax casting, is a precision manufacturing technique that is ideal for producing intricate metal parts with an excellent surface finish and tight tolerances. Owing to its versatility with materials and design, it caters to a wide range of industries, including:

1. Automotive Industry

  • Engine components, turbocharger impellers, transmission parts, and brackets
  • Ensures strength, durability, and performance for both standard and high-end vehicles

2. Industrial Machinery

  • Pump housings, impellers, valve bodies, gear wheels
  • Suitable for heavy-duty use with intricate designs and high strength requirements

3. Agricultural Equipment

  • Housings, couplings, levers, and structural parts for tractors and harvesters
  • Built for long service life and resistance to harsh outdoor environments

4. Oil & Gas Sector

  • Valve components, pipe connectors, seals, and tool parts
  • Withstands high pressure and corrosive conditions in both upstream and downstream operations

5. Medical and Dental Equipment

  • Surgical tools, dental implants, orthopaedic devices
  • Made from biocompatible materials with high precision for patient safety

6. Marine Applications

  • Propellers, pump cases, deck hardware, and fittings
  • Cast from corrosion-resistant metals for saltwater exposure

7. Firearms and Defence Equipment

  • Triggers, receivers, bolt carriers, scope mounts
  • Supports reliable performance and precision in safety-critical parts

8. Food and Beverage Processing Equipment

  • Sanitary pipe fittings, nozzles, blades, and mixer components
  • Produced in food-grade stainless steel to ensure hygiene and corrosion resistance

9. Art, Jewellery, and Decorative Pieces

  • Sculptures, fine jewellery, trophies, ornaments
  • Allows for detailed, intricate designs with a high-quality finish

10. Renewable Energy Systems

  • Wind turbine couplings, solar panel brackets, hydro components
  • Designed for durability and performance under varying weather conditions

11. Railway and Public Transport

  • Brake shoes, couplings, structural links, and suspension parts
  • Provides robustness and wear resistance for long-term operation

12. Construction and Infrastructure

  • Pipe brackets, cable supports, safety clamps, scaffolding parts
  • Durable and strong components for buildings, tunnels, and bridges

13. Electronics and Electrical Hardware

  • Heat sinks, connectors, contact terminals, sensor housings
  • Enables complex miniaturised parts with good electrical conductivity

14. Mining and Earthmoving Equipment

  • Excavator teeth, wear-resistant liners, cutting edges
  • Designed to handle abrasive and impact-heavy environments
